'98 Winstar 3.8L head gasket. How much?

Hi, Friend's '98 winstar is blowing white smoke out of its tail pipe. Coolant is disappearing from the overflow bottle. I'm assuming it's the head gasket. How much would it cost to replace it? Is there any other thing that would cause it to blow white smoke? I think its timing belt was just replaced a few weeks ago... I read timing belt cover gasket has something to do with oil/coolant in the newsgroup. I'm not too familar with it. Can someone shed some light on it?

38 does not have a timing belt - it has timing chain. Timing cover gaskets CAN leak antifreeze. If oil has gotten into the oil on a 3.8 you can kiss it good bye.
